Нужно из файла вычитать бинарные данные. Ща делаю через hGetArray.Не очень устраивает, что вычитывает только байтами. Вопросы: 1. Можно ли указать, чтоб вычитывалось, например, по 16, 32 бита ? 2. Как объединить 8-ми битные (например, 0xA и 0xB - байты, нужно получить число 0xAB и т.д.). 3. Ну и вообще может с бинарными данными как-то по другому работать? Хотелось бы, чтоб вычитывалось списком, а элементами списка были бы: байт, 2 байта, 3 байта и т.д., по выбору.
Ответ на:
комментарий
от pierre
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от imp
Ответ на:
комментарий
от brahman
Ответ на:
комментарий
от pierre
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ум Ocaml и бинарные данные (2008)
- Форум Удобная упаковка/распаковка бинарных форматов по описанию? (2017)
- Форум SQL database binary data store (2005)
- Форум Haskell binary package for gentoo (2013)
- Форум Странное поведение recvmsg (2014)
- Форум Binary data in C variable (for BDB) (2004)
- Форум Криптографический хэш огромного массива/btree с быстрой вставкой в середину (2025)
- Форум Посоветуйте структуру данных (2022)
- Форум Питон и бинарные данные. (2012)
- Форум Binary HTML (2016)